MBSki 1114 Posted July 27, 2020 Posted July 27, 2020 There seems to be a small glitch in scheduling programs to record. If I search on a program, select one and click "record series", the Channels only displays 1 of the channels that the Program is available on. Why isn't it showing all the channels that the Program is available on? In this example I apparently clicked the SD Program not the HD Program, so it only shows the SD channel. I suppose the first question should be, "why is the search showing 2 different Programs for the same Program?" it should just show 1 Program that includes all the channels that the 1 Program is available on. Is there a glitch in LiveTV/DVR? Is there a different way to schedule a recording that avoids this issue?
ebr 16184 Posted July 27, 2020 Posted July 27, 2020 Hi. This is because the search is returning individual programs on individual channels and you chose the one on that channel. In the future, search will hopefully be able to group these but, for now, you need to pay particular attention to the channel if that is important for you. 1

Carlo 4561 Posted July 27, 2020 Posted July 27, 2020 What I did was create an Excel spreadsheet with the channels. I used the HDHomeRun app in web view to copy paste the channel info into excel. Then I could sort easily by name to find the SD dupes of HD channels and track them. When cable providers move mass channels around it's a pain in the butt as you have to rescan channels. HDHomeRun kept my SD channels hidden when the name matched but they added some additional channels and removed others so still had some manual work today. Kind of goes with the territory. Only 1 big change for me in the last 5 years so keeping fingers crossed. I've run both Verizon Fios and Comcast Xfinity both through two different HDHomeRun Primes and that made things interesting. Carlo 4561 Posted July 27, 2020 Posted July 27, 2020 (edited) Good question I myself can't answer as I sort of cause my own grief in a one respect. With the HDHomeRuns you can mark your channels as a favorite and also to remove channels. So I make use of the favorite feature so I can keep my Emby Live TV grid/guide info smaller to channels I care about but still allow the tuner to server up other channels which I can access with LiveChannels or something else for the occasional other view. In Emby when I setup my tuners I have it set to only import channels that are favorites. Thus until I manually scan and make favorites, Emby will not know. Now with my IPTV "tuners" Emby does update my lineup based on different streams in the M3U files so for them a definite YES. EDIT: Emby will auto adjust to channel changes but I don't know if it does any re-scanning of channels or how often the device does this on it's own. Edited July 27, 2020 by cayars
